Why is high-precision equipment necessary for organic acid Varroa control? Protect Your Colony with Precision


High-precision equipment is the critical firewall between effective pest control and colony collapse. It is necessary because organic acids like formic and oxalic acid operate within a very narrow "therapeutic window." Without specialized devices to regulate evaporation rates and distribution, you risk either failing to penetrate brood cells to kill mites or creating toxic spikes that harm larvae and queens.

Core Takeaway The effectiveness of organic acid treatment relies entirely on maintaining a stable chemical concentration over time, regardless of external variables. Specialized equipment regulates volatilization against fluctuating temperatures, ensuring the vapor is strong enough to kill mites—even those hiding in capped brood—while preventing the toxic surges that damage the colony's health.

The Delicate Balance of Formic Acid Application

Formic acid is unique because it can penetrate capped brood cells, but this capability comes with significant risks that only precision equipment can mitigate.

Controlling Volatility and Temperature

Formic acid is highly volatile. Its evaporation rate fluctuates wildly depending on the ambient temperature.

High-precision evaporation devices, such as glass dosing meters or gel carriers, regulate this release. They ensure the volatilization rate remains safe, specifically within the critical temperature range of 10 to 25 degrees Celsius.

Preventing Larval Toxicity

If the evaporation rate spikes due to heat or poor equipment, the concentration of acid vapor rises too quickly.

This sudden increase can cause neurotoxic damage to honeybee larvae and may even kill the queen. Precision evaporators act as a governor, keeping the release constant to prevent these lethal spikes.

Penetrating the Brood Cap

To kill Varroa mites hiding inside capped cells, the acid vapor must maintain a constant, elevated concentration over several days.

Simple or manual application methods often fail to sustain this pressure. Specialized evaporators ensure the vapor pressure is sufficient to penetrate the wax cappings without causing toxicity to the developing bees inside.

Optimizing Oxalic Acid for Maximum Kill Rates

While formic acid relies on vapor pressure, oxalic acid relies on direct contact and distribution, necessitating a different type of precision.

Targeting Phoretic Mites

Oxalic acid is primarily effective against "phoretic" mites—those riding on adult bees.

To be effective, the treatment must achieve a kill rate of over 95 percent during this stage. Specialized spraying or dripping equipment is required to hit this high benchmark.

Ensuring Uniform Distribution

The solution must be spread evenly across the bee cluster.

High-precision dripping or spraying equipment ensures that every bee receives the correct dosage. This maximizes the surface area treated while preventing the formation of "hot spots" where high concentrations could damage the bees' digestive systems or mouthparts.

Understanding the Trade-offs

Using high-precision equipment reduces risk, but it does not eliminate the need for beekeeper vigilance.

The Limits of Automation

Even the best equipment cannot fully compensate for extreme environmental conditions.

If ambient temperatures fall outside the recommended 10 to 25 degrees Celsius range, even precision formic acid evaporators may fail to release enough vapor to be effective, or conversely, release it too quickly during a heatwave.

Purity and Equipment Integrity

Precision equipment often requires high-purity, industrial, or pharmaceutical-grade acids.

Using low-purity acids in precision devices can lead to clogging or the generation of harmful by-products during evaporation. This can compromise the safety of the honey and the health of the bees.

Making the Right Choice for Your Goal

Selecting the correct equipment depends heavily on the specific lifecycle stage of the colony and the mites.

  • If your primary focus is treating capped brood: Use a specialized formic acid evaporator capable of maintaining stable vapor concentrations over several days to penetrate wax cappings.
  • If your primary focus is the phoretic stage (mites on adult bees): Use high-precision oxalic acid spraying or dripping equipment to ensure uniform distribution and a kill rate exceeding 95%.

Precision is not a luxury; it is the prerequisite for ensuring organic treatments remain lethal to parasites but harmless to the colony.
